Gold ¼ Stater - East WiItshire Savernake Wheel
Issuer | Dobunni tribe (Celtic Britain) |
Year | 55 BC - 45 BC |
Type | Standard circulation coin |
Value | ¼ Stater |
Currency | Stater |
Composition | Gold |
Weight | 1.2 g |
Dimensions | 9 mm |

Reference(s) | ABC#2101 , Van Arsdell#246 , Sp#48 , BMC Iron#546 , Mack#75 |
Obverse description | Abstracted head of Apollo right (wreath design). Crescents below. Pelleted spike. |
Obverse script | |
Obverse lettering | |
Reverse description | Horse right, double tail, strap around belly, pellet-in-ring motifs on shoulder and haunch. Solar spiral above. Seven-spoked wheel below. |
